Which components are part of a comprehensive energy management plan?

Prepare for the PE Environmental Exam. Study with flashcards and multiple choice questions, each with hints and explanations. Ace your exam with confidence!

A comprehensive energy management plan focuses on optimizing energy use and promoting sustainability within an organization or community. Energy audits are an essential component, as they involve a thorough investigation of energy consumption patterns. This helps identify areas for improvement, enhances efficiency, and leads to cost savings.

Renewable energy integration is another critical aspect; it involves incorporating renewable energy sources such as solar, wind, or biomass into the existing energy systems. This not only helps reduce reliance on fossil fuels but also contributes to achieving sustainability goals and mitigating climate change impacts.

Together, energy audits and renewable energy integration provide a well-rounded approach to energy management, facilitating effective planning and implementation strategies that can lead to both immediate and long-term benefits.
